Beirut Strike Night From A Reporter On The Ground
- William Christou described waking to nonstop ambulances and seeing collapsed buildings after explosions in Beirut.
- He reported Israel hit over 100 targets in 10 minutes, creating one of Lebanon's deadliest mass-casualty events in decades.
Safe Zones Shattered By Coordinated Strikes
- The strikes shattered the idea of safe zones in Lebanon as attacks hit across the city simultaneously.
- Christou noted the scale and coordination made the attacks unusually lethal and overwhelmed hospitals and emergency services.
Hospitals Overwhelmed With Gaza‑Like Casualties
- Christou described Lebanon's national day of mourning and ongoing rescues with an initial death toll around 254.
- He relayed doctors' accounts of children arriving without parents, mass amputations and scenes similar to Gaza.
